首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

整除尾数(整除问题) - HDU 2099

我们先不管题目水不水,按部就班踏实学就好了,只要是没见过就用心领会。...Problem Description 一个整数,只知道前几位,不知道末二位,被另一个整数除尽了,那么该末二位该是什么呢?...Output 对应每组数据,将满足条件所有尾数在一行内输出,格式见样本输出。同组数据输出,其每个尾数之间空一格,行末没有空格。...解题思路: 1、由于只用考虑末尾2位,比如200和40,也就是200xx除以40,那么只需要遍历20000到20099就好了 2、遍历过程如果能够整除就输出 3、注意输出格式 源代码:G++ 0ms.../为了输出格式,这里需要一个临时变量控制一下 int c = 0; for (int i = 0; i < 100; ++i) { //如果能够整除就输出

89810

Python整除和取模实例

//: 6//4 1 2//3 0 // 得到整除结果,但是结果并不一定是整数类型,它与分母分子数据类型有关系: 6//4.0 1.0 2.0//3 0.0...故当整除运算有负数时,结果稍有不同: 4//-3 -2 -10//3 -4 我们通常计算,采用是向零取整方法计算,4//-3 = -1,-10//3 = -3。...: 21%10 1 3%4 3 但是由于Python采用是向下取整方式,所以对负数取余结果不一样: -21%10 9 -5%4 3 结合前面负数整除计算,可以理解取模结果..." – 对Python来说,负数索引表示从右边往左,最右边元素索引为-1,倒数第二个元素为-2.,。。。...list[-1] = e In [1] list = ["a", "b", "c", "d", "e"] print(list[-1]) e 以上这篇Python整除和取模实例就是小编分享给大家全部内容了

4K20

Excel公式练习39: 求字符串数字组成能够被指定数整除个数

本次练习是:在单元格A1输入一个任意长度字母数字字符串,请使用公式返回该字符串能够被3、5或7整除数字数量。这里,“字符串数字”指字符串可以被认为是数字任意长度连续子字符串。...所以,该字符串能够被3、5或7整除数字数量为9。...(我们也要考虑公式灵活性,即不仅适用于这里给出3个,还应适用于其他任意给出) 但是,现在我们想要同时测试是否能被这3个整除,而不是一个一个来。...3、5、7整除结果组成数组,即1代表该行可以被3、5、7某个数整除,2代表该行可以被3、5、7某两个数整除,3代表该行可以被3、5、7三个整除。...3、5或7整除,将得到数组与0相加,将TRUE/FALSE强制转换成1/0,然后传递给SUM函数求和,得到值9,也就是该字符串中分拆出能够被3、5或7整除个数。

1.6K40

【Python 千题 —— 基础篇】输出可以被5整除

题目描述 输出40以内可以被5整除,每一个数字间隔一个空格。 输入描述 无输入。 输出描述 输出40以内可以被5整除。...示例 示例 ① 输出: 0 5 10 15 20 25 30 35 40 代码讲解 下面是本题代码: # 描述: 输出40以内可以被5整除,每一个数字间隔一个空格 # 输入: 无输入 # 输出:...输出40以内可以被5整除 # 使用 for 循环遍历范围为0到40 for num in range(0, 41): # 判断是否能被5整除 if num % 5 == 0:...if num % 5 == 0: 输出符合条件,以空格间隔: 如果当前能被5整除,就输出该,同时以空格间隔。...print(num, end=' ') 这样,程序会使用 for 循环遍历范围为0到40,并输出40以内可以被5整除,每一个数字之间用一个空格隔开。

21630

【刷题篇】领扣3171.找出1- n 能被 x 整除(python)

在本文中,我们将探索一道关于数学和Python编程挑战题目:找出1-n能被x整除。通过这个练习题,我们将深入了解Python编程在数学问题中应用,锻炼我们数学思维和编程技能。...本文Python程序练习题 在本文中,我们将探索一道有趣且富有挑战性Python程序练习题目:找出1-n能被x整除。...题目:找出1-n能被x整除 在这个练习题中,我们目标是找出1-n中所有能够被给定x整除。...找出1- n 能被 x 整除 描述 请在 solution . py 里完善代码,定义一个名为 myfunc 函数, myfunc 函数接收两个 int 类型参数 n 和 x ,找出在1到 n...通过实践和应用,我们可以更深入地理解和掌握Python强大功能。 本文Python程序练习题涉及数学和Python编程结合,我们通过编程找出了1-n能够被给定数x整除

10210

python整除和取余写法_Python整除和取余

大家好,又见面了,我是你们朋友全栈君。 最近做题发现-123%10=7,于是查阅了一下python取余机制,这里记录。...参考:https://blog.csdn.net/sun___M/article/details/83142126 //:向下取整 int():向0取整 正数取余比较直接: print(123%10)...但是换为负数取余,情况就有所不同: print(-123%10) #7 print(-123%-10) #-3 这里面第二条是我们一般意义上取余操作。...这个结果有点让人摸不到头脑,不过这个结果与Python底层机制有关。 在Python,取余计算公式与别的语言并没有什么区别:r=a-n*[a//n] 这里r是余数,a是被除数,n是除数。...不过在“a//n”这一步,当a是负数时候,我们上面说了,会向下取整,也就是说向负无穷方向取整。

1.7K20

Python编程经典案例【考题】求某个范围内能被3整除且能被5整除所有数,及这些

本文目录 经典案例【考题】 经典案例解题方法 2.1 通过for循环求出满足条件并求和 2.2 通过for循环求出满足条件存到列表并求和 一、经典案例【考题】 问题:1000能被3整除且能被...5整除所有正整数及这些和 输入: 1000 输出: 1000能被3整除且能被5整除正整数有 15 1000能被3整除且能被5整除正整数有 30 1000能被3整除且能被5整除正整数有...step2:应用if语句判断是否既能被3整除,又能被5整除,若能则打印出该,并统计到求和参数。...step2:应用if语句判断是否既能被3整除,又能被5整除,若能则把该添加到列表。 step3:打印列表和列表求和结果。...至此,Python编程经典案例【考题】求某个范围内能被3整除且能被5整除所有数,及这些和已讲解完毕。

1.9K30

数组重复

之前有写过 找出数组只出现一次,今天再来看下怎么找出数组重复出现。 有一个长度为 n 数组,所有的数字都在 0~n-1 范围,现在要求找出数组任意一个重复数字。...思路一: 先给数组排序,然后再遍历一遍有序数组,依次比较相邻元素,就很容易能找出数组重复值。使用快排排序的话时间复杂度为 O(nlogn) 。...思路二: 利用空间换时间思想,新建一个哈希表,然后遍历数组,每扫描一个元素都去哈希表里查找是否也存在该元素,如果存在,即找到一个重复,如果不存在,则将该元素保存到哈希表。...== i,换句话说就是不断调整数组,使其满足 arr[i] == i,比如数组第一个元素 arr[0] 为 4 ,那就要把元素 4 放到下标为 4 位置上去。...推荐文章: 找出数组只出现一次 我给自己配置第一份保险 每天微学习, 长按加入一起成长.

1.6K20

js如何实现随机切换

,数字随机切换等,为了吸引用户注意力,增加网页互动性,这个效果是怎么实现呢 具体示例 随机 01 随机切换图片代码 <!...images文件夹里面 通过相对路径方式去实现,上面定时器内代码也可以使用for循环去实现 实现这个效果,需要借助一个定时器,点击图片显示和暂停时,需要借助一个开关按钮即可实现 02 实现随机切换...具体代码如下所示,当使用原生js方法能实现后,在用vue或等其他一些框架,在里面实现相同效果,核心代码实现依旧是没有变 ...,在一定数值范围内生成随机 定义一个random()函数,原理是随机和最大值减最小值差相乘,最后再加上最小值 其中Math.floor()浮点数向下取整 Math.floor(Math.random...() * (max - min)) + min 其他,都是与原生js实现都是一样,同样用是定时器,加上一个开关去实现

7.7K40
领券